如何检查用户是否已登录?
像:
<?php unless user_is_signed_in
echo "Please log in"
end
?>
Mage::getSingleton('customer/session')->isLoggedIn();
或者
Mage::helper('customer')->isLoggedIn();
第二种方法调用第一种方法 -见这里
所以以辅助方法为例...
$isLoggedIn = Mage::helper('customer')->isLoggedIn();
if (! $isLoggedIn) {
echo "Please log in";
}
使用客户助手:
$this->helper('customer')->isLoggedIn()